// branchMetaReadBackoffs paces the re-reads of a branch-meta sidecar that
// failed to load. On Windows fileutil.ReplaceFile can fall back to a
// non-atomic in-place copy, so a concurrent reader may catch the sidecar
// half-written (an open/read error or truncated JSON). Those tears heal in
// milliseconds; a few short retries separate them from real corruption.
var branchMetaReadBackoffs = []time.Duration{20 * time.Millisecond, 50 * time.Millisecond, 100 * time.Millisecond}
// loadBranchMetaRetry reads the branch-meta sidecar like LoadBranchMeta but
// retries transient failures (I/O errors and undecodable JSON) before giving
// up. A missing sidecar is a legitimate state — a session that has never
// recorded meta — and returns ok=false immediately without retrying.
func loadBranchMetaRetry(sessionPath string) (BranchMeta, bool, error) {
var lastErr error
for attempt := 0; ; attempt++ {
meta, ok, err := LoadBranchMeta(sessionPath)
if err == nil {
return meta, ok, nil
}
lastErr = err
if attempt >= len(branchMetaReadBackoffs) {
return BranchMeta{}, false, lastErr
}
time.Sleep(branchMetaReadBackoffs[attempt])
}
}
func SaveBranchMeta(sessionPath string, m BranchMeta) error {
return saveBranchMeta(sessionPath, m, true)
}
func SaveBranchMetaPreserveUpdated(sessionPath string, m BranchMeta) error {
return saveBranchMeta(sessionPath, m, false)
}
func saveBranchMeta(sessionPath string, m BranchMeta, touchUpdated bool) error {
metaPath := BranchMetaPath(sessionPath)
if metaPath == "" {
return fmt.Errorf("empty session path")
}
now := time.Now().UTC()
if m.ID == "" {
m.ID = BranchID(sessionPath)
}
if m.CreatedAt.IsZero() {
m.CreatedAt = now
}
if touchUpdated || m.UpdatedAt.IsZero() {
m.UpdatedAt = now
}
if existing, ok, err := LoadBranchMeta(sessionPath); err == nil && ok {
preserveBranchMetaPersistence(&m, existing)
}
if err := os.MkdirAll(filepath.Dir(metaPath), 0o755); err != nil {
return err
}
b, err := json.MarshalIndent(m, "", " ")
if err != nil {
return err
}
b = append(b, '\n')
tmp, err := os.CreateTemp(filepath.Dir(metaPath), ".branch.*.tmp")
if err != nil {
return err
}
tmpPath := tmp.Name()
if _, err := tmp.Write(b); err != nil {
tmp.Close()
os.Remove(tmpPath)
return err
}
if err := tmp.Close(); err != nil {
os.Remove(tmpPath)
return err
}
if err := fileutil.ReplaceFile(tmpPath, metaPath); err != nil {
os.Remove(tmpPath)
return err
}
return nil
}
